Caroline Wozniacki, World No. 1 and 2009 Family Circle Cup finalist, has officially committed to the 2011 Family Circle Cup event.

Throughout her six-year WTA career, Wozniacki has notched 13 singles titles, 248 singles victories, won over $8.5 million in prize money, and she became the 20th woman to top the rankings when she overtook Serena Williams’ World No. 1 position on October 11, 2010. As the first Dane, male or female, to hold the top ranking, Wozniacki finished the 2010 season as the World No. 1 player.

The 20-year-old from Denmark started her 2011 season off by reaching the semifinal of the Australian Open, claiming her 13th singles title in Dubai, and making an appearance in the finals of Doha.
